Keirin Champions Crowned as UCI Fastest Man & Woman on Wheels Concludes at Valley Preferred Cycling Center

TREXLERTOWN, Pa. — Three days of world-class international racing came to a thrilling conclusion Saturday as the UCI Fastest Man & Woman on Wheels wrapped up at the Valley Preferred Cycling Center.

The final event featured elite endurance racing, a high-speed Madison, and the always-popular Keirin, where riders draft behind a pacing motorcycle before unleashing explosive sprint finishes that can reach speeds exceeding 40 mph.

The headline races of the event were the Pro-Am Keirin Finals.

In the Women's Keirin, Nicole Hacohen Monteros of PACE timed her sprint perfectly to capture victory ahead of Valentina Mendez and Emy Savard. Hacohen Monteros posted a winning 200-meter time of 12.315 seconds.

The Men's Keirin provided a dramatic showdown between two of the competition's top sprinters. Taeho Choi of Gyeongsangbuk-do Sports Council powered to the win over James Hedgcock, while Nicholas Roberts of Edge Cycling claimed third. Choi's winning 200-meter time was 11.716 seconds.

Earlier in the event, Stephanie Lawrence of Star Track won the Women's Elimination Race, leading a dominant performance by the team as Kimberly Zubris finished second. Reagen Pattishall of Turbo Velo Pickle Juice completed the podium.

The Men's Scratch Race saw Enzo Edmonds of Star Track take the victory in a fast and aggressive 30-lap contest. Kyle Perry of First Internet Bank Cycling finished second while George Nemilostivijs of Team BSR earned third.

The Men's Points Race featured constant attacks and sprint battles throughout 90 laps. Chris Ernst of Team Canada emerged victorious with 69 points, ahead of John Borstelmann of TeamBSR Mustangs and Enzo Edmonds of Star Track.

The Women's Madison provided one of the most exciting races of the event as the Star Track duo of Stephanie Lawrence and Kimberly Zubris combined for a commanding victory with 55 points. The CCACHE Body Wrap pairing of McKenzie Milne and Lucy Reeve finished second, while Star Track teammates Mia Deye and Dannielle Watkinson earned bronze.

The UCI Fastest Man & Woman on Wheels once again brought together some of the world's best track cyclists, delivering three days of international competition and showcasing why the Valley Preferred Cycling Center remains one of the premier velodromes in North America.
